Breathing light exercises provide a gateway to building up a higher tolerance to carbon dioxide (CO2), which plays a crucial role in regulating our breathing patterns. CO2 is not just a waste gas; it's a powerful signal for our bodies to breathe and maintain physiological balance.

By embracing the art of "breathe light," you can unlock a host of advantages, such as improved blood flow to the brain through the dilation of blood vessels and maximizing the renowned Bohr Effect. This effect allows a higher concentration of CO2 in the blood, enhancing oxygen uptake and delivery to vital organs and tissues.
